About The Position

Amazon’s Creator Services leads creator programs that span media, commerce, and culture. The Creator Services team includes Creator Partnerships, creator content studio Wondery, and physical production facilities Studio126. We connect creators and Amazon’s diverse businesses, helping bring big ideas to life across Wondery, Amazon Music, Twitch, Audible, Amazon Games, and beyond. Join us in making Amazon the home for creators. Creator Services is seeking a Creator Operations Manager. The Creator Operations Manager operationalizes Creator deals across verticals, serving as the connective tissue between Creator Partnerships, Creative, and CAP, with expertise in production. This role owns operational excellence, quality standards, scalable processes, and cost discipline across a diverse portfolio of Creator programs and all content formats. By serving as an advisor to Creator production teams, this position enables Partner Managers to focus on strategic relationship-building.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of producer, production manager or line producer experience
  • 5+ years of budgeting, scheduling and cost reporting experience
  • Experience with on-set problem solving
  • 5+ years in content operations, production management, or creator/talent production support
  • Extensive experience producing industry-leading video podcasts and digital series featuring A-list talent

Nice To Haves

  • Background in the creator economy, talent management, or client-facing account management
  • Proficiency with production tools (Airtable, Descript, Dropbox, Iconik)

Responsibilities

  • Own the production control layer across all Creator Services content — enforcing quality, cost, and delivery standards portfolio-wide.
  • Serve as the production control tower: triaging off-track deliverables, enforcing SLAs, auditing calendars, and standardizing processes.
  • Own metadata standards in partnership with Distribution. Maintain a vetted vendor and facilities database.
  • Provide on-site and field support as needed.
  • Provide structured operational support to Partner Managers, enabling them to focus on strategic relationships.
  • Manage production workflows including creator onboarding, delivery tracking, compliance, and milestones.
  • Build trusted relationships with creator production leads. Coordinate cross-functionally across BA, CAP, GTM, Content Optimization, Finance, and Legal to remove blockers.
  • Help creators build competencies to meet deliverable standards.
  • Serve as production lead within the integrated ad workflow, partnering with CAP to hold advertising content to the same quality bar as core content.
  • Maintain centralized tracking for schedules, SLAs, and ad/social production. Lead production-day direction, post approval, compliance QC, and final delivery.
  • Own feasibility, product integration, QC, and budget accounting for branded content.
  • Enforce processes for short-form and social production.
  • Process and QC all show and vendor invoices. Enforce budget discipline, flag cost leakage, and track actuals against forecasts with Finance.
  • Absorb unscoped work to prevent delivery failures.
  • Design scalable content operations processes. Integrate AI and automation to improve efficiency. - Build dashboards for program health and operational metrics.
  • Document best practices and create reusable frameworks.
